Signed Paul Buhre, no. 3843, retailed by Heyworth Watch Co., stamped with London import letter for 1925
With gilt-finished lever movement, 35 jewels, bimetallic compensation balance, Westminster carillon minute repeating on four polished steel hammers onto four gongs, gold cuvette, the gilt matte dial with Breguet numerals, blued steel moon-style hands, subsidiary seconds, in plain circular case with repeating slide in the band, case stamped with casemaker's initials HBB and W.H.S, London import letter for 1925 and engraved Heyworth Watch Co., dial signed Paul Buhré, movement also engraved Heyworth Watch Co.
55 mm. diam.

The Buhré dynasty of watch makers, starting with Paul-Léopold Buhré around 1815, was specialized in the manufacture of high quality watches for the Russian market.

The present watch is fitted with a Westminster carillon repeating mechanism, more complicated than the "normal" quarter or minute repeating function and more commonly found in clock watches. The quarter hours of the present watch are stroke on four hammers onto four gongs and chime the Westminster tune.
